JAMDAT Acquires Hexacto Games

JAMDAT Mobile announced the acquisition of <a href="http://www.hexacto.com">Hexacto Games</a>, a provider of games for Palm, Pocket PC and cell phones.

As a result of the acquisition, JAMDAT will add Hexacto's entire library of original and branded titles to its slate, and integrate Hexacto's Montreal-based development team into its publishing business. Hexacto Games develops casual games primarily for the Pocket PC, Smartphone and Palm platforms. Its line-up of original games includes Tennis Addict, Baseball Addict, The Emperor's Mahjong, and Lemonade Tycoon; the company has also developed games based licensed properties, including Worms World Party, Kasparov Chessmate, Hoyle, and Micrsoft's Links. The terms of the deal were not disclosed.
